There are several educational requirements to become a studio technician. Studio technicians usually study fine arts, communication, or photography. 72% of studio technicians hold a bachelor's degree, and 16% hold an associate degree. We analyzed 983 real studio technician resumes to see exactly what studio technician education sections show.

| Rank | Major | Percentages |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Fine Arts | 19.7% |
| 2 | Communication | 19.6% |
| 3 | Photography | 12.3% |
| 4 | Audiovisual Communications Technologies | 7.4% |
| 5 | Digital Media | 6.4% |

| Studio technician education level | Studio technician salary |
|---|---|
| High School Diploma or Less | $30,535 |
| Bachelor's Degree | $34,700 |
| Some College/ Associate Degree | $33,083 |
